    The Productivity Institute (TPI) at the Alliance Manchester Business School (AMBS) is seeking to appoint a Postdoctoral Research Associate undertake an economic and business landscape analysis on the impact of the rise in Artificial Intelligence on productivity, business models and regulatory frameworks.

    The position is based at The Productivity Institute's headquarters at the Alliance Manchester Business School, and supports the Institute's participation in the UKRI-funded Responsible AI (RAI) project, titled Responsible & Trustworthy Economic Landscape analysis (April 2024-March This project is run from the University of Cambridge, involving amongst other Professors Diane Coyle and Adrian Weller, and King's College London.

    The position is also meant to contribute to the development of a joint research programme on AI, Digital Transformation and Productivity at the Alliance Manchester Business School between various centres and institutes at AMBS involved with digital and AI-related research, including The Productivity Institute, the Decision and Cognitive Sciences Research Centre, the Manchester Institute of Innovation Research, and the Digital Transformation Research Group.

    The PDRA will report to The Productivity Institute Managing Director, Professor Bart van Ark, and will be accountable to an Academic Advisory Group consisting of Professors Nadia Papamichail and Richard Allmendinger (Decision and Cognitive Sciences Research Centre), Panos Constantinides (Digital Transformation Research Group), Philip Shapira (Manchester Institute of Innovation Research), Nikolay Mehandjiev (Data Visualisation Observatory) and Markos Zachariadis (Centre for Financial Technology (FinTech) Studies).
